Celebrate Red Ribbon Week at Woodlands Elementary! (Oct. 27–31)
Dear Woodlands Families,
We’re excited to celebrate Red Ribbon Week from October 27th–31st, 2025! This week is all about promoting healthy choices, kindness, and unity within our school community. Each day, students can participate in themed dress-up days that encourage teamwork and positive decision-making just like puzzle pieces that fit together to make something amazing!
Here’s what’s happening each day:
Mixed Up Monday – “Piece It Together” Kick off the week in mismatched clothes! Life can feel scrambled like puzzle pieces, but healthy choices help put it together.
Teamwork Tuesday – “We Fit Together” Dress alike with a friend or group! Just like puzzle pieces, we fit better when we work together.
Wacky Word Wednesday – “Solve the Riddle” Wear a shirt with a positive word, riddle, or uplifting message. Students can decode each other’s messages throughout the day!
Togetherness Thursday – “Complete the Puzzle” Each grade wears a different color so our school forms one giant puzzle of unity:
· VPK & KG – Blue
· 1st – Red
· 2nd – Green
· 3rd – Orange
· 4th – Yellow
· 5th – Purple
Fun Friday – “Show Your Spirit!” Wear your Woodlands shirt and show your school pride!
